Types of Electric Tools

Electric tool sets typically consist of a range of tools that deal with various functions. Here’s a breakdown of some important types:

1. Power Drills

  • Used for drilling holes and driving screws into numerous products.
  • Corded vs Cordless: Cordless drills use mobility, while corded drills provide consistent Power Tool Sets On Sale.

2. Saws

  • Reciprocating Saws: Ideal for demolition and rough cuts.
  • Circular Saws: Used for straight cuts in wood and other materials.
  • Jigsaws: Perfect for intricate cuts.

3. Sanding Tools

  • For smoothing surfaces and preparing materials for finishing.
  • Alternatives consist of belt sanders, orbital sanders, and detail sanders.

4. Impact Wrenches

  • Excellent for tightening or loosening nuts and bolts rapidly, typically used in automotive work.

5. Angle Grinders

  • Used for cutting, grinding, and polishing various surface areas, suitable for metal and concrete jobs.

6. Multi-Tools

  • Flexible tools that combine features of numerous tools into one, frequently great for smaller tasks.

Functions to Consider When Choosing an Electric Tool Set

When selecting an electric tool set, there are a number of crucial functions to think about:

  • Power Source: Determine if you prefer corded tools (normally more effective) or cordless tools (more portable).
  • Battery Life: For cordless options, consider the battery’s charge capability and availability of spares.
  • Weight and Size: Heavier tools might provide more power; nevertheless, they can result in fatigue.
  • Ergonomics: An ergonomic design makes sure comfort during extended use.
  • Consisted of Accessories: Some sets feature extra devices, such as drill bits and blades, which adds worth.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How do I pick an electric tool set for my needs?

  • Figure out the jobs you plan on taking on, consider the size and complexity, and examine which tools will be most beneficial.

2. Are corded tools much better than cordless tools?

  • Corded tools generally provide constant Power Tool Combo and can be more powerful, while cordless tools provide benefit and mobility. It eventually depends upon the user’s needs.

3. What upkeep do electric tools require?

  • Standard maintenance consists of routine cleaning, checking electrical cords, and charging batteries as needed. Particular tools might have their own requirements.

4. Can I use electric tools for DIY home projects?

  • Absolutely! Electric tools can make home enhancement tasks simpler and more enjoyable. It’s crucial to comprehend the tools you are utilizing to ensure security and effectiveness.

5. How do I ensure safety when using electric tools?

  • Constantly use proper security gear, detach power when altering attachments, and follow the manufacturer’s standards.
